The statistical theory of Keplerian orbits is used to determine initial conditions that lead rapidly to radial focusing of a particle stream. Computer simulations of radial focusing are performed for several initial distributions of eccentricity and inclination. The results obtained for nine different cases indicate that, depending on initial conditions, a Keplerian particle stream can contract into a monolayer or form a stable ring, a series of small stable rings, two apparently unstable rings, or a sequence of ringlets and gaps.
